Yeah, that was my post on pistonheads. You could also try the option in the photo above, although it does seem to have a very bright bias. Bright being high treble. That guy has boosted treble twice, once using the treble slider and then additional treble via the equalizer (his high frequencies are boosted)

This can give an initial appearance of more detailed sound but after a while, it can actually introduce listening fatigue and then the sound starts to become unpleasant to listen to. Especially if you're listening at a higher volume.

There is a big mid range drop that probably can't be corrected without changing the speakers but overall, it's a fairly good sound system and it can comfortably match the bass output of a high quality pair of stand mount hifi speakers. It easily beats my Bmw upgraded sound system, that's for sure.

Well mastered tracks on the Spotify app with extreme quality streaming selected sound very nice indeed. Tracks with an emphasis on vocals sound particularly good and my Spotify playlists for the car are based around content that the system does a good job with. It will struggle more with tracks with a lot going on, like the Beatles I am the Walrus type songs, the system isn't good enough to separate all the nuanced detail.

The white noise floor is excellent, an inky black silence on well mastered tracks which really elevates the content and overall listening experience. A perfect example is the song how far I'll go from the Moana movie soundtrack. Typically high quality Disney master for Cinemas and converts well to the 320kbps Spotify stream. Trying various content like this helps you get a feel for what strengths the system has, and you then modify your playlists to suit.
